Hirato City, also known as Kakuoka City, is located on the seaside of Hirato City, Nagasaki Prefecture, Japan. It was built from 1587 and burned to the fire until 1718. It is composed of multiple buildings, surrounded by sea on three sides, and the city is 50 meters high. Opening hours: 8:30~ 17:30 Address: Iwaokacho, Hirai, Nagasaki Prefecture 1458 Tickets: 520 yen for adults

Kumamoto Castle, a national treasure in Japan, is an awe-inspiring symbol of resilience and history. This majestic fortress, dating back to the 17th century, stands as a testament to Japan's architectural and cultural heritage. Despite enduring the test of time and natural disasters, it has been meticulously restored to its former glory. The castle's imposing stone walls, elegant turrets, and pristine gardens create a picturesque scene that's a delight for history enthusiasts and photographers alike. Exploring its interior, filled with artifacts and exhibits, offers a glimpse into the past. Kumamoto Castle is a must-visit destination that beautifully encapsulates Japan's rich historical legacy.
